Grateful Shred have announced plans for Halloween. The band, known for its West Coast-rooted, easy-going and harmony-driven approach to accentuating the music of the Grateful Dead, will take its collective talent to The Capitol Theatre in Port Chester, N.Y., on Friday, October 31, 2025, for a night dubbed All Hallow’s Eve with Special Guests. Costumes encouraged!
The group, Austin McCutchen, Dan Horne, Adam MacDougall, Austin Beede, John Lee Shannon, and Alex Koford, is wrapping its Spring East tour, which began in mid-April. It will conclude over two nights at The Charleston Pour House in Charleston, S.C., on May 10 and 11.
Following the band’s Spring East tour closer, Grateful Shred will participate in a series of regional gigs next month, beginning at The Crystal Bay Club Casino in Crystal Bay, Nev., on June 5. Then, the ensemble will take part in California follow-ups: San Francisco (June 6-7), Los Angeles (June 13), San Diego (June 14) and San Luis Obispo (June 15).
An August 1 outlier will bring the band, and special guests Circles Around the Sun (Horne’s other band), to The Zoo Amphitheatre in Oklahoma City, Okla., for a musical celebration of the late Jerry Garcia on his birthday.
Apart from their touring commitments, on April 29, Grateful Shred announced its debut album, Might As Well, due out on June 6, featuring special guest and collaborator Mikaela Davis, who led the group’s initial single, the Donna Jean and Keith Godcheaux track “Sweet Baby.” Read the album announcement here.
